Manager, Environmental Programs

TORONTO HYDRO
Toronto, ON, CA

Reporting to the Director, Environment, Health and Safety, the Manager, Environmental Programs is responsible for the design, implementation and execution of planned activities to support the environmental management systems.

This includes ensuring policy compliance, risk mitigation, continual improvement, adherence to international standards, and compliance with legislative requirements.

The role involves leading a small team of professionals to provide environmental program / project support, improve organizational performance, and assist internal business leaders in addressing environmental hazards, risks, and incidents.

The incumbent supports the environment audit program to identify, non-compliance and non-conformance findings as well as manage the closure of associated corrective actions.

The incumbent provides support to the serious incident review process, and works with the Director, EHS to support the resolution of environmental issues

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ES :

  • Lead all proactive and reactive environmental program work, including execution, maintenance and improvement of ISO 14001 management system elements including, but not limited to, forecasting, planning, execution, and reporting
  • Provide recommendations to the organization’s environmental strategies, business plans, and programs
  • Lead environmental impact assessments to evaluate the impact of utility projects, providing recommendations for minimizing negative effects and enhancing sustainability, leading to the successful implementation of mitigation strategies
  • Consolidate and analyze environmental data to assess trends and drive improvements in EHS programs and processes
  • Author internal and external environmental compliance reports and support annual plan completion
  •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to identify environmental risks, establish objectives, and develop programs for continual improvement and compliance
  • Design and implement environmental programs, procedures, and training
  • Manage escalated environmental issues and liaise with external rule enforcement agencies and provide onsite emergency support working with various emergency agencies as necessary
  • Manage a team who provide planned and reactive environment client support, including advice, consultation, incident investigations, and oversight within the Environmental delivery program
  • Manage investigations related to environmental matters and provide front-line EHS leadership at incident sites; as needed
  • Review client environmental compliance, develop improvement plans, and monitor completion
  • Lead the continual review and renewal of Toronto Hydro environmental policies, processes, and systems
  • Consolidate and present environment-related performance data, make recommendations, and implement continuous improvement plans
  • Manage the day-to-day activities performed by a small internal team and external subject matter experts / vendors. Manage safety, attendance, performance and training and development
  • Provide coaching and feedback to motivate and engage employee outcomes in the attainment of departmental goals and objectives
  • Lead and implement departmental environment, health and safety projects and initiatives (proactive and reactive) as required to drive performance improvements and outcomes

REQUIREMENTS :

  • Undergraduate university degree in environmental practice, health, safety, or related science field
  • Five (5) years of progressive experience in environment, health & safety program design, development, implementation, and reporting, including auditing
  • 2 years in environment program design
  • Three (3) to five (5) years of progressive people / project leadership experience
  • Canadian Registered Safety Professional (CRSP) or Environmental Professional (EP) designation
  • Experience working with environment, health and safety management systems (EHSMS) strongly preferred
  • Master's degree in science, preferably in fields related to environmental practice, occupational health, safety, or a related science field is an asset
  • Utility / industry experience is an asset
  • Fully conversant in Environmental audit processes and root cause corrective action processes
  • Experience adhering with ISO 14001 compliance standards and environmental management activities is preferred
  • Knowledge of current industry Environment regulations, standards and best practices
  • Project Management, Stakeholder Engagement, Facilitation, and Change Management skills
  • Negotiation skills and the ability to influence others
  • Problem solving and decision-making skills
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ills

Toronto Hydro has introduced a Hybrid Work Arrangement. This position allows for remote work up to three days per week, based on business needs.

Employees will be required to come onsite on those days when they are involved in activities that they or their leader feel are better conducted in person.

You are expected to live in Ontario and within reasonable commuting distance of the office.
